- In America, there are 87 million more pets than people.
- 63% of households own a pet.
- 62% of pet owner are without children.
35% of pet owners characterize pets as children.
- 35.9 billion dollars is spent anually on pets in the US.
(20 billion dollars is spent anually on toys for children.)
- 2.4 billion dollars were spent in 2005 on boarding and grooming.
- More then 31 million dog owners purchase Christmas gifts for their dogs, according to The American Pet Association.
- More than 370 bomb-sniffing dog teams now patrol 72 airports across the country -- an 86% increase since 2001.
